119th CONGRESS
  2d Session
                                S. 4984

To amend the Rehabilitation Act of 1973 to ensure workplace choice and
            opportunity for young adults with disabilities.

_______________________________________________________________________

                   IN THE SENATE OF THE UNITED STATES

                             July 15, 2026

  Mr. Cotton introduced the following bill; which was read twice and
  referred to the Committee on Health, Education, Labor, and Pensions

_______________________________________________________________________

                                 A BILL

To amend the Rehabilitation Act of 1973 to ensure workplace choice and
            opportunity for young adults with disabilities.

    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,

S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.

    This Act may be cited as the ``Restoration of Employment Choice for
Adults with Disabilities Act''.

SEC. 2. USE OF SUBMINIMUM WAGE.

    Section 511 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973 (29 U.S.C. 794g) is
amended--
            (1) in subsection (a)--
                    (A) in the matter preceding paragraph (1)--
                            (i) by striking ``No'' and inserting
                        ``Any'';
                            (ii) by striking ``24 or younger'' and
                        inserting ``18 or older''; and
                            (iii) by striking ``unless'' and inserting
                        ``if''; and
                    (B) by inserting at the end the following new
                paragraph:
            ``(3) The individual chooses to accept employment with such
        entity.'';
            (2) in subsection (b)(2), by striking ``24'' and inserting
        ``17'';
            (3) in subsection (c), by inserting at the end the
        following new paragraph:
            ``(4) Other exceptions.--The entity described in subsection
        (a) can satisfy the requirements of paragraph (1)(A) with
        respect to an individual, if--
                    ``(A) such entity makes documented efforts, at the
                intervals described in paragraph (2), to contact on
                behalf of the individual, the designated State unit for
                the counseling, information, and referrals described in
                paragraph (1)(A); and
                    ``(B) such designated State unit fails to provide
                such counseling, information, and referrals after such
                documented efforts.''; and
            (4) in subsection (d)(1), by inserting before the period at
        the end the following: ``and, if such individual is employed by
        an entity described in subsection (a) at the time such
        documentation is made pursuant to such process, to make
        available copies of such documentation to the entity''.

SEC. 3. APPLICATION.

    The amendments made by this Act shall apply with respect to the
employment of an individual on or after the date of enactment of this
Act.
